Peru is a land of breathtaking diversity, where towering mountains, vibrant cultures, and ancient civilizations meet. From the majestic Andes to the lush Amazon rainforest, this country offers endless adventure and discovery. Explore the iconic Machu Picchu, a stunning relic of the Inca Empire, or wander through the charming streets of Cusco, once the heart of the Inca civilization. Lima, the bustling capital, blends modern city life with rich culinary traditions, making it a must-visit for food enthusiasts. Peru's warmth, history, and natural beauty will leave you captivated from start to finish.

Arequipa, known as the 'White City' due to its stunning white volcanic stone architecture, is the second-largest city in Peru. Surrounded by majestic volcanoes, it offers a blend of colonial history, modern life, and natural beauty. Arequipa is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, renowned for its beautiful churches and vibrant culture.

Lima, the capital and largest city of Peru, is a vibrant metropolis known for its rich history, colonial architecture, and diverse culinary scene. Located on the Pacific coast, Lima offers a mix of ancient and modern attractions, making it a must-visit destination for travelers.

Iquitos, located in the heart of the Amazon rainforest, is Peru's largest city that is not accessible by road. Known for its vibrant culture and unique location, Iquitos is a gateway to exploring the Amazon River and its diverse wildlife.
